Honda Elevate vs Mahindra Thar Roxx: which should you buy?

The Honda Elevate starts at ₹11.81L against the Mahindra Thar Roxx's ₹12.52L ex-showroom Delhi, so it is ₹0.71L cheaper to get into.

They run together up to ₹16.36L, where the Elevate tops out. Past that only the Thar Roxx has anything left to sell you, up to ₹23.53L.

Fuel is a real difference here: the Elevate comes in petrol, the Thar Roxx in petrol and diesel.

Same money, which car?

Take ₹16.36L to both showrooms and you come out with the Elevate ZX at ₹16.36L or the Thar Roxx MX3 at ₹16.28L.

Honda Elevate

ZX Petrol AT

₹16.36L ex-showroom Delhi

Mahindra Thar Roxx

MX3 Diesel MT

₹16.28L ex-showroom Delhi₹0.08L of the budget left over

Our take

The real reason to pay ₹0.08L more for the Elevate ZX: level 2 (core suite) ADAS, blind spot monitor and single-pane sunroof. The useful extras on top: connected car tech and speakers (8 against 4). The rest of the additions are minor trim. At that price, we would stretch.

  • The Thar Roxx MX3 is the strongest of the two at 152 PS
  • Also on the Elevate ZX: driver display (7" digital against Semi-digital), auto climate (single zone), auto headlamps and auto-folding wing mirrors, and some minor trim beyond that
  • Going to the Elevate ZX, you give up hill descent control, drive modes and terrain modes, which the Thar Roxx MX3 keeps
Choose the Mahindra Thar Roxx MX3 if
You would rather keep the ₹0.08L than pay for kit you will not miss
Choose the Honda Elevate ZX if
You will do long stints in this car and want the daily comforts

Elevate vs Thar Roxx, on paper

 Honda ElevateMahindra Thar Roxx
Price (ex-showroom Delhi)₹11.81L to ₹16.36L₹12.52L to ₹23.53L
Variants718
Body typeMidsize SUVOff-road SUV (5-door)
Seats55
FuelsPetrolPetrol, Diesel
Cheapest automatic₹13.43L₹15.28L
Boot458 litres447 litres
Length4,312 mm4,428 mm
Width1,790 mm1,870 mm
Wheelbase2,650 mm2,850 mm
Ground clearance220 mm226 mm
Fuel tank40 litres57 litres
Turning radius5.2 m-
Warranty3 years-

Which is cheaper as an automatic, the Honda Elevate or the Mahindra Thar Roxx?
The Elevate: its cheapest automatic is ₹13.43L against ₹15.28L for the Thar Roxx, ex-showroom Delhi. A gearbox is usually the biggest single step on either ladder, so check what else that trim brings before you read it as the price of the automatic alone.
